Projet

Général

Profil

Bug #10008

vérif de signature (seal) sips2

Ajouté par Frédéric Péters il y a environ 8 ans. Mis à jour il y a environ 8 ans.

Statut:
Fermé
Priorité:
Normal
Assigné à:
Version cible:
Début:
16 février 2016
Echéance:
% réalisé:

0%

Temps estimé:
Patch proposed:
Oui
Planning:

Fichiers

0001-sips2-fix-seal-check-10008.patch (1,28 ko) 0001-sips2-fix-seal-check-10008.patch Frédéric Péters, 16 février 2016 21:56

Révisions associées

Révision 3b3f6390 (diff)
Ajouté par Frédéric Péters il y a environ 8 ans

sips2: fix seal check (#10008)

Historique

#1

Mis à jour par Frédéric Péters il y a environ 8 ans

  • Statut changé de Nouveau à En cours
  • Patch proposed changé de Non à Oui
  1. les paramètres sont décodés/réencodés et dans l'affaire l'ordre est perdu, utilisation de OrderedDict pour contrer ça. (l'alternative étant de ne pas coder/recoder mais ça demande plus de modifs dans le code)
  2. récupération correcte de la valeur du paramètre Seal (parse_qs créant des listes, il manquait le [0] pour prendre la valeur).
#2

Mis à jour par Benjamin Dauvergne il y a environ 8 ans

Il doit manquer un fichier attaché.

#4

Mis à jour par Benjamin Dauvergne il y a environ 8 ans

Je remplacerai le data = {} par un data = collections.OrderedDict() dans la construction de la requête aussi, au cas où, sinon c'est ok.

#5

Mis à jour par Frédéric Péters il y a environ 8 ans

  • Statut changé de En cours à Résolu (à déployer)

Poussé avec la modification suggéréeé.

commit 3b3f63907d7ba309b55e69c5eeda38076664de95
Author: Frédéric Péters <fpeters@entrouvert.com>
Date:   Tue Feb 16 20:38:03 2016 +0100

    sips2: fix seal check (#10008)
#6

Mis à jour par Frédéric Péters il y a environ 8 ans

  • Statut changé de Résolu (à déployer) à Solution déployée
#7

Mis à jour par Benjamin Dauvergne il y a environ 8 ans

  • Version cible mis à 1.5

Formats disponibles : Atom PDF